Transition Towards 100% Renewable Energy is a comprehensive academic book featuring selected papers from the World Renewable Energy Congress (WREC) 2017, edited by Ali Sayigh. This publication focuses on the latest advancements and research in renewable energy technologies, providing valuable insights for professionals and students alike.

Key Features of the Book

  • Collection of Selected Papers: Curated from WREC 2017, showcasing innovative research and developments in renewable energy.
  • Focus on Renewable Energy Transition: Addresses critical topics related to the shift towards sustainable energy systems.
  • Target Audience: Ideal for researchers, professionals in the renewable energy sector, students in environmental science, and policymakers.
  • Publication Year: 2018, ensuring the content is current and relevant.
  • ISBN: 9783319698434 for reference and citation.
